Slice through the carpet with a utility knife, cutting through carpet, but not the padding.The price of removing glued carpet is typically higher than that of regular carpet removal. The cost to rip up carpet is around $1.30 to $2.10 per square foot. Glued-down carpet requires more labor than carpet held down with tacks and staples. The contractor will need to cut it to remove it, then use a scraping tool to remove the glue residue. The Live with Kelly and Mark stars …6 days ago · 1 Pull up the carpet. Start by cutting a strip 4cm wide and 1m long in one corner of the carpet. Use a flat head screwdriver and a wrecking bar to gently pry the strip off the tacks underneath. When you can reach in under the carpet, pull up the whole corner. Then follow the edge around, pulling the carpet up and rolling it into the centre of ... Place vast chunks of dry ice in a pan and place the pan on top of a glue patch. Allow 10 minutes for the glue to freeze, and then use a scraper to lift and break the glue apart.
